jQWidgets jqxDraw getAttr()方法

  • Post category:jquery

以下是关于“jQWidgets jqxDraw getAttr() 方法”的完整攻略,包含两个示例说明:

简介

jqxDraw 控件的 getAttr 方法用于获取指定元素的属性值。该方法可以用于获取指定元素的位置、大小、颜色等属性值。

完整攻略

下面是 jqxDraw 控件 getAttr() 方法的完整攻略:

  1. 获取指定元素的属性值
var value = element.getAttr('attributeName');

在上述代码中,我们使用 getAttr() 方法获取了指定元素的属性值。

示例

以下两个示例演示如何使用 getAttr() 方法。

示例1

在此示例,创建了一个 jqxDraw 控件,并使用 rect() 方法创建了一个矩形元素。然后,使用 getAttr() 方法获取了矩形元素的位置和颜色属性值。

<div id="jqxDrawContainer"></div>

<script>
    $(document).ready(function () {
        // 创建 jqxDraw 控件
        var draw = new $.jqx.draw($("#jqxDrawContainer")[0], {
            width: 300,
            height: 200
        });

        // 创建矩形元素
        var rect = draw.rect(100, 100);

        // 获取矩形元素的位置和颜色属性值
        var x = rect.getAttr('x');
        var y = rect.getAttr('y');
        var fill = rect.getAttr('fill');

        // 输出矩形元素的位置和颜色属性值
        console.log('x: ' + x + ', y: ' + y + ',: ' + fill);
    });
</script>

在上述代码中,我们创建了一个 jqxDraw 控件,并使用 rect() 方法创建了一个矩形元素。然后,使用 getAttr() 方法获取了矩形元素的位置和颜色属性值。

示例2

在此示例中,创建了一个 jqxDraw 控件,并使用 circle() 方法创建了一个圆形元素。然后,使用 getAttr() 方法获取了圆形元素的半径属性值。

<div id="jqxDrawContainer"></div>

<script>
    $(document).ready(function () {
        // 创建 jqxDraw 控件
        var draw = new $.jqx.draw($("#jqxDrawContainer")[0], {
            width: 300,
            height: 200
        });

        // 创建圆形元素
        var circle = draw.circle(50);

        // 获取圆形元素的半径属性值
        var radius = circle.getAttr('r');

        // 输出圆形元素的半径属性值
        console.log('radius: ' + radius);
    });
</script>

在上述代码中,我们创建了一个 jqxDraw 控件,并使用 circle() 方法创建了一个圆形元素。然后,使用 getAttr() 方法获取了圆形元素的半径属性值。

结语

以上是关于“jQWidgets jqxDraw getAttr() 方法”的完整攻略,包含方法的介绍和获取指定元素的属性值的示例。在实际开发中,可以根据需要使用 getAttr() 方法,获取指定元素的属性值。